So, I just got it today and there are a few things that could be a problem for potential buyers. First thing, the voltage on the back was set to 220v instead of 110v which would not have been a problem if the unit's power switch wasn't already on. So the moment I connected my power cord, it semi turned on, the number dials did not turn on and the two driver tubes didn't light up... wasn't until I checked the back did I notice it was set on 220v. Don't know if it caused damage or not. It's a case of lower voltage into higher voltage device, so probably not. Just make sure to check the voltage on the unit before plugging it in.
Second is that the tube trays especially the rectifier tray is loose, don't know if that's be design or not, but when I try seating the rectifier tube, it does not feel reassuring as it doesn't seat firmly. The driver tubes are not as loose.

Other than the tube tray for the rectifier, the unit seems well built. Can't wait to share some listening impressions.
